november 2006

Supreme Court of India · 2006-11-24

MOHAMMED ARSHAD vs STATE OF MAHARASHTRA .

Judgment text excerpt

The Supreme Court upheld the conviction under Section 302/34 IPC, affirming the life imprisonment sentence imposed by the High Court. The Court emphasized the admissibility of multiple dying declarations made by the deceased, which were consistent and corroborated by witness testimonies. The Court found that the evidence presented sufficiently established the guilt of the appellants in the murder of Kayyum, rejecting their appeals against the conviction.
